Transaction 66350fc41ed21351f65fc11e7f95e12232dd4a2c79a4262b42435ab84c3a8694
1 Input
1 Output
-
66350fc41ed21351f65fc11e7f95e12232dd4a2c79a4262b42435ab84c3a8694:0
- value
- 4010000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d3ea2d3cda697c40ee057575e51211f16c1509c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JFdkHWRPsvUqFuMaKXA7vACsFT6VA46gb